Madrid puts another electric bus line into operation
In the Spanish capital Madrid, the municipal transport company EMT has put another electric bus line into operation. Five electric buses from Irizar are used on Line 75. Prague orders 20 e-buses from Solaris & Skoda Electric
The Prague transport operator DPP has ordered 20 double-articulated trolleybuses from the consortium of Solaris Bus & Coach, Solaris Czech and Škoda Electric. BAE Systems takes orders for 340 hybrid drive systems
The Southeastern Pennsylvania Transportation Authority (SEPTA) has selected BAE Systems to supply up to 340 hybrid electric drive systems for its new fleet of low emission transit buses. GAC Aion finishes first of two capacity expansions
GAC Aion, the electric car offshoot of China’s GAC Group, has completed the expansion of its existing production facility to an annual capacity of now 200,000 electric cars. Tesla reached a cumulative million of its new-format cells in January
Tesla produced its millionth large-format 4680 battery cell in January, according to a tweet from the company’s official account posted Friday. The 4680 cells, so far made at a facility in California, are key to Tesla’s plans to continue boosting range and performance while lowering cost.
